In-Text who dares bee so bold as to confront God, and charge them with any matter of blame and fault in his sight? seeing the heavenly voyce hath also given warning from heaven saying, The things that God hath made cleane, let no man count unclean, Act. 10. But guiltie-making sinne, only causing condemnation, being thus perfectly taken away and utterly abolished, who shall condemn them? Why not? Why? Because it is Christ, who is dead for them, that is, Christ hath undergone by death all condemnation both temporall and eternall, that they should have borne; who dares be so bold as to confront God, and charge them with any matter of blame and fault in his sighed? seeing the heavenly voice hath also given warning from heaven saying, The things that God hath made clean, let no man count unclean, Act. 10.
